Isuzu D-Max 2.5 (Single Cab) 4×2 MT Dsl (2015) vs Mitsubishi Mirage 1.2 GLX MT (2016): which should you buy?
For a Filipino buyer deciding between the Isuzu D‑Max 2.5 (Single Cab) and the Mitsubishi Mirage 1.2 GLX, the choice hinges on purpose rather than price alone. The D‑Max is a pickup built on a body‑on‑frame chassis, offering 109 PS and 280 Nm of torque from a 2.5‑liter turbo diesel, which is well suited for hauling or off‑road duties and provides a 100 000 km/3‑year warranty. Its RWD drivetrain and two‑door layout make it ideal for commercial or rugged use, though its length (5195 mm) and heavier build limit maneuverability in tight city streets. In contrast, the Mirage is a compact hatchback with 78 PS and 100 Nm from a 1.2‑liter naturally aspirated gasoline engine, better suited for daily commuting and urban driving. It is lighter, has a front‑wheel drive layout, five doors for easier passenger access, and a more economical engine that will likely cost less to run. The Mirage’s lower price (₱630,000 vs ₱762,000) and smaller size also mean easier parking and lower depreciation for a city‑centric buyer. Thus, if you need a vehicle for work or occasional heavy loads, the D‑Max is the logical pick; if you prioritize city commuting, fuel economy, and lower upfront cost, the Mirage is preferable.
